jsf - 从支持 bean 更新 PrimeFaces 数据表

标签 jsf primefaces

我在bean中使用schedule(Timer),当员工注册从指纹设备获取数据时,它会更新变量。当 bean 中的变量更新时,我需要从支持 bean 更新 jsf 中的组件。我尝试使用 primefaces poll 组件,但它每次都会更新组件。

最佳答案

假设您将使用来自 Fingerprint 设备 API 的 Listener 调用 Java 方法,并且从 ManagedBean 您可以使用 RequestContext 更新任何 Primefaces 组件。 。

RequestContext.getCurrentInstance().update("ID_OF_YOUR_DATATABLE")

关于jsf - 从支持 bean 更新 PrimeFaces 数据表,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19159598/

相关文章:

java - JSF,将空值注册到绑定(bind)实例

jsf - primefaces 命令按钮 oncomplete 未触发

jsf - Primefaces 数据表重置和重新加载数据

primefaces - 不为 Primefaces 5.0 呈现的折线图

更新/删除查询中的 javax.persistence.TransactionRequiredException

java - hibernate - "org.hibernate.LazyInitializationException: could not initialize proxy - no Session"

ajax - 如何捕获以质数过滤数据表的事件

ajax - 在 ajax 事件上禁用/启用命令按钮

jsf - 如何将 SelectManyCheckbox 与两个 ArrayList 一起使用? - Primefaces

spring - 运行 JSF 2 webapp 时 Application.getResourceHandler 中的 java.lang.UnsupportedOperationException